Smarter Campuses, Inside the Property Line: Lighting & Water Management

Two often-overlooked areas can have a big impact on campus safety, appearance, operating costs, and sustainability. In this two-part session, experts from Outdoor Lighting Perspectives and Conserva Irrigation will share practical strategies schools can use to evaluate and improve their exterior environments.

First, learn how to assess campus lighting after dark, identify problem areas, and create safer, more welcoming entrances, walkways, parking areas, and gathering spaces. Then, turn your attention underground to uncover hidden irrigation issues, reduce water waste, prioritize repairs, and better manage one of your campus’s most valuable resources.

Two separate topics, one practical session—and plenty of ideas to help your campus work smarter outside.
